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

A package in the form of a pouch comprises a first flexible sheet part 6 and a second flexible sheet part 7 . The pouch comprises a first permanent seal 14 between the first sheet part 6 and the second sheet part 7 along a first edge 12 of the pouch. The pouch comprises a second permanent seal 15 between the first sheet part 6 and the second sheet part 7 along a second edge 13 of the pouch opposite to the first edge 12 . The pouch comprises a first temporary seal 16 between the first sheet part 6 and the second sheet part 7 , the first temporary seal 16 extending across the pouch between the first permanent seal 14 and the second permanent seal 15 . The pouch comprises a second temporary seal 17 between the first sheet part 6 and the second sheet part 7 , the second temporary seal 17 extending across the pouch between the first permanent seal 14 and the second permanent seal 15 . The pouch comprises a first compartment 20 bounded by the first sheet part 6, the second sheet part 7 , the first permanent seal 14 , the second permanent seal 15 and the first temporary seal 16 and a second compartment 21 bounded by the first sheet part 6, the second sheet part 7 , the first permanent seal 14 , the second permanent seal 15 , the first temporary seal 16 and the second temporary seal 17.

First claim

Opening claim text (preview).

The invention claimed is: 1. A package in the form of a tobacco pouch comprising: a first flexible sheet part; a second flexible sheet part; a first permanent seal between the first sheet part and the second sheet part along a first edge of the pouch; a second permanent seal between the first sheet part and the second sheet part along a second edge of the pouch opposite to the first edge; a first temporary seal between the first sheet part and the second sheet part, the first temporary seal extending across the pouch between the first permanent seal and the second permanent seal; a second temporary seal between the first sheet part and the second sheet part, the second temporary seal extending across the pouch from the first permanent seal to the second permanent seal; a first compartment bounded by the first sheet part, the second sheet part, the first permanent seal, the second permanent seal and the first temporary seal; and a second compartment bounded by the first sheet part, the second sheet part, the first permanent seal, the second permanent seal, the first temporary seal and the second temporary seal, wherein the first sheet part is longer than the second sheet part and wherein a portion of the first sheet part which is not overlapped by the second sheet part comprises a flap for the pouch, and wherein the first and/or the second temporary seal is formed in sealing areas of the first and second flexible sheet part respectively, wherein sealing areas are limited on each of their sides by folding lines and are folded from a wide surface area of the first and second flexible sheet part, wherein each folding line is folded at an angle of 70° to 120° relative to a wide surface area of the first or the second sheet part, respectively. 2. The package according to claim 1 wherein the first sheet part and the second sheet part are parts of a continuous flexible sheet, with the second sheet part folded against the first sheet part or wherein the first sheet part and the second sheet part are separate pieces of flexible sheet and the package further comprises a third permanent seal between the first sheet part and the second sheet part along a third edge of the pouch. 3. The package according to claim 1 , wherein at least one of the first temporary seal and the second temporary seal comprise a peelable adhesive seal, a resealable seal, a resealable adhesive seal, or a resealable fixing. 4. The package according to claim 1 , wherein the first temporary seal comprises or consists of a peelable seal and the second temporary seal comprises or consists of a resealable seal. 5. The package according to claim 1 , wherein at least one of the first temporary seal and the second temporary seal further comprises a resealable fixing. 6. The package according to claim 1 , wherein the flexible sheet parts comprise adhesive properties which vary according to temperature applied to the sheet parts, wherein the sheet parts have a first adhesion value at a first applied temperature and a second adhesion value at a second applied temperature, wherein the second adhesion value is lower than the first adhesion value and the second temperature is lower than the first temperature. 7. The package according to claim 1 , wherein the flap comprises a temporary seal for sealing the flap against the pouch. 8. The package according to claim 1 , wherein the second temporary seal is offset from a free edge of the second sheet part to form a throat of the pouch, wherein the first sheet part is overlapped by the second sheet part at the throat. 9. The package according to claim 1 , wherein at least one of the compartments comprises a further seal between the first sheet part and the second sheet part which divides the compartment into two sub-compartments. 10. A package in the form of a tobacco pouch comprising: a first flexible sheet part; a second flexible sheet part; a first permanent seal between the first sheet part and the second sheet part along a first edge of the pouch; a second permanent seal between the first sheet part and the second sheet part along a second edge of the pouch opposite to the first edge; a first temporary seal between the first sheet part and the second sheet part, the first temporary seal extending across the pouch between the first permanent seal and the second permanent seal; a second temporary seal between the first sheet part and the second sheet part, the second temporary seal extending across the pouch from the first permanent seal to the second permanent seal; a first compartment bounded by the first sheet part, the second sheet part, the first permanent seal, the second permanent seal and the first temporary seal, the first compartment accessible through an opening created by the first temporary seal and the second temporary seal; and a second compartment bounded by the first sheet part, the second sheet part, the first permanent seal, the second permanent seal, the first temporary seal and the second temporary seal, wherein the first sheet part is longer than the second sheet part and wherein a portion of the first sheet part which is not overlapped by the second sheet part comprises a flap for the pouch, and wherein the first and/or the second temporary seal is formed in sealing areas of the first and second flexible sheet part respectively, wherein sealing areas are limited on each of their sides by folding lines and are folded from a wide surface area of the first and second flexible sheet part, wherein each folding line is folded at an angle of 70° to 120° relative to a wide surface area of the first or the second sheet part, respectively. 11. The package of claim 1 or claim 10 , further comprising sealing areas 81 of the first and second flexible sheet part respectively, wherein sealing areas 81 are limited on each of their sides by folding lines and are folded from a wide surface area of the first and second flexible sheet part, wherein each folding line is folded at an angle of 70° to 120° relative to a wide surface area of the first or the second sheet part, respectively.
